kavkema (singular kavkem) are a sapient Nekenalosan species (“nyaqena”) evolved from Cretaceous Deinonychosaurs. Unlike the Nayabaru, they have barely physically changed since the Cretaceous.

Their name likely etymologically stems from the word kavama (which to them now means hatchling capable of speech).

Body language

Apology is denoted with a significant dip of the muzzle. A confirmation is given with a raised muzzle's side to side swerve; the gesture can range from very subtle to an enthused shake of the head, but there is always a sway or twist to the motion. Negation is expressed with a single upward flick of the muzzle, with intensity conveyed by the distance covered by the tip of the muzzle.
